The Trust Problem in Hotel Booking

Hotel quality concerns are rising. In 2025, 65% of hotels report ongoing staffing shortages, many have switched to on-request housekeeping, and the gap between marketed experience and reality keeps widening. Travelers are responding by moving beyond star ratings and polished photos—toward authentic guest feedback as their primary trust signal.

This shift creates a clear opportunity: platforms that surface genuine guest insights (not just aggregated scores) can differentiate on trust. That's exactly what the Booking.com Hotel Tips API enables.

What the Hotel Tips API Does

The API returns curated tips left by verified guests for a specific hotel. These aren't full reviews—they're short, actionable nuggets: the kind of advice a friend would share after staying somewhere.

5 Ways Teams Use Hotel Tips

01

Booking-Page Trust Layers

Display guest tips directly on hotel detail pages. Instead of only showing a score, show what past guests actually recommend—"ask for a room facing the courtyard", "the rooftop bar closes early on weekdays". These micro-signals reduce booking anxiety.

02

Smart Hotel Comparison

When users compare two properties, surface relevant tips side-by-side so they can see real trade-offs—not just price and rating differences.

03

Post-Booking Guidance

After a user books, send a "tips from past guests" email. This adds value, reduces support tickets, and sets accurate expectations.

04

Content & SEO

Power "what guests say" sections in destination guides and blog posts. Guest tips provide unique, crawlable content that search engines value.

05

Quality Monitoring

Track recurring tip themes (positive and negative) across your inventory to flag properties where guest experience is declining before ratings drop.
